Samsung launched the Galaxy M33 5G smartphone in India, which was introduced about a month ago. For the first buyers, the novelty is available at a price of 210 and 230 dollars for versions with 6/128 GB and 8/128 GB of memory. In retail, they will ask for it already 235 and 255 dollars, respectively.
Recall that the smartphone is characterized by a single-chip Samsung Exynos 1280 system, a 6.6-inch IPS screen with Full HD + resolution and a frame rate of 120 Hz, an 8 MP front camera, a main quad camera with modules of 50 MP, 8 MP, 2 MP and 2 MP, a 6000 mAh battery, support for 25 W wired charging (without a power adapter included) and a pre-installed Android 12 OS with a proprietary OneUI 4.1 shell.
